Gene Expression Data
Assay Details
Assay
Reference: J:50547 Matsumoto K, et al., Molecular cloning and distinct developmental expression pattern of spliced forms of a novel zinc finger gene wiz in the mouse cerebellum. Brain Res Mol Brain Res. 1998 Oct 30;61(1-2):179-89
Assay type: RNA in situ
MGI Accession ID: MGI:3830649
Gene symbol: Wiz
Gene name: widely-interspaced zinc finger motifs
Probe: Wiz original clone
Probe preparation: Antisense labelled with S35 RNA
Visualized with: Autoradiography
